Integrating Family Planning Interventions into District Implementation Plans in Malawi

Successful execution of Malawi’s Costed Implementation Plan (CIP) for Family Planning (2016–2020) requires engaging district councils to increase their awareness of national objectives and strategies and empowering them to develop district-level plans based on the CIP. HP+ collaborated with the Ministry of Health’s Reproductive Health Directorate to facilitate CIP implementation at the district level by supporting the integration of priority CIP activities into district implementation plans  This guide outlines the approach used by HP+, with the intention of enabling others to replicate and refine it beyond the life of the project.
